Who we are:
The Conservation Ecology Centre is a growing NGO that works collaboratively and creatively with stakeholders to address urgent conservation challenges in the Otways region of Victoria and beyond. Through our research, we deepen understanding and contribute to healthy, resilient ecosystems, whilst developing innovative land management solutions that produce tangible, real-world impacts.
About the role:
We are seeking a Project Officer to support the delivery of projects, particularly including a major feral pig management program across the Otways. This full-time role is based out of our headquarters at Cape Otway and requires regular travel to remote project sites throughout the region.
The Project Officer will play a key role in deploying and maintaining monitoring cameras in dense bush, conducting field surveys and engaging with a diverse range of stakeholders. The position also involves a mix of hands-on fieldwork and office-based tasks, offering a dynamic work environment.
